Indonesian Natural Compounds As Potential Anti-Colorectal Cancer Agents: A Systematic Review
Abstract
Colorectal cancer (CRC) remains a major global health burden, with increasing incidence and mortality worldwide, including in Indonesia. Natural products have long been recognized as a valuable source of anticancer agents, yet many studies on Indonesian natural resources focus on crude extracts rather than isolated compounds with defined mechanisms of action. This study aimed to systematically review isolated natural compounds derived from Indonesian biological sources with reported anti-colorectal cancer activity. A systematic review was conducted following Preferred Reporting Items for Systematic Reviews and Meta-Analyses (PRISMA) 2020 guidelines, with literature searches performed in PubMed, SpringerLink, and ScienceDirect. Eligible studies included original experimental research investigating isolated compounds against CRC models with quantitative outcomes. A total of 16 studies were included, identifying diverse compounds from terrestrial plants, marine organisms, and propolis. Several compounds demonstrated potent cytotoxic activity, particularly in the low micromolar range, and were associated with apoptosis induction and cell cycle arrest. Mechanistic analysis revealed involvement of caspase-dependent pathways, NF-κB inhibition, and ROS-mediated apoptosis. However, many studies lacked detailed mechanistic validation and in vivo evidence. Absorption, Distribution, Metabolism, Excretion, and Toxicity (ADMET) profiling indicated generally favorable pharmacokinetic properties, although potential toxicity risks and variability in absorption were observed. Overall, Indonesian natural compounds represent promising candidates for CRC therapy, but further studies are needed to improve mechanistic understanding, validate efficacy in vivo, and assess pharmacokinetic and safety profiles.
